Strona 1 z 1
Problem z Kernelem
: 16 września 2007, 14:23
autor: Los
Witam, mam taki problem, mianowicie postanowiłem skompilowac jądro, i zrobić to wg drugiej metody opisanej na tej stronie:
http://www.debian.org/doc/manuals/refer ... el.pl.html
Jednak przy poleceniu "make menuconfig" wyrzuca taki błąd:
Kod: Zaznacz cały
dbnnsh:/usr/src/linux# make menuconfig
HOSTCC scripts/kconfig/mconf.o
scripts/kconfig/mconf.c:91: error: static declaration of ‘current_menu’ follows non-static declaration
scripts/kconfig/lkc.h:63: error: previous declaration of ‘current_menu’ was here
make[1]: *** [scripts/kconfig/mconf.o] Błąd 1
make: *** [menuconfig] Błąd 2
dbnnsh:/usr/src/linux#
Chciałem przy okazji podkreślić że jestem nowym użytkownikiem forum, i moje pojęcie o Debianie, wogóle o linuksie jest narazie ograniczona.
Z góry dzięki za pomoc.
Pozdrawiam £oś
: 16 września 2007, 14:32
autor: qbsiu
http://dug.net.pl/faq/faq-6-79-Kompilacja_jadra.php ja kiedyś tak kompilowałem..
Teraz pobieram źródła ze strony kernel.org

rozpakowuje w /usr/src
robię dowiązanie i kompiluję!
http://dug.net.pl/faq/faq-6-109-Jak_sko ... ernela.php
: 16 września 2007, 14:55
autor: Los
Mimo wszystko mój problem jest dalej aktualny, jest ktoś w stanie mi pomóc?
: 16 września 2007, 15:20
autor: ilin
Pewnie brakuje ci paczki
zeby wyświetlilo make menuconfig
Pozdrawiam
: 16 września 2007, 15:31
autor: Los
Mam zainstalowane libncurses5-dev. Co dalej?
: 16 września 2007, 15:39
autor: sirgomo
w katalogu scripts powinienes miec plik ver_linux sprawdz nim zalezonosci... to powinno rozwiazac problem
zdravim
: 16 września 2007, 15:43
autor: Los
Kod: Zaznacz cały
dbnnsh:/usr/src/linux/scripts# ./ver_linux
If some fields are empty or look unusual you may have an old version.
Compare to the current minimal requirements in Documentation/Changes.
Linux dbnnsh 2.6.18-4-686 #1 SMP Mon Mar 26 17:17:36 UTC 2007 i686 GNU/Linux
Gnu C 4.1.2
Gnu make 3.81
binutils 2.17
util-linux 2.12r
mount 2.12r
module-init-tools 3.3-pre2
e2fsprogs 1.40-WIP
Linux C Library 2.3.6
Dynamic linker (ldd) 2.3.6
Procps 3.2.7
Net-tools 1.60
Console-tools 0.2.3
Sh-utils 5.97
Modules Loaded ipv6 dm_snapshot dm_mirror dm_mod loop parport_pc parport evdev floppy rtc intel_agp
agpgart serio_raw psmouse i2c_piix4 pcspkr shpchp i2c_core pci_hotplug ext3 jbd mbcache ide_cd cdrom
ide_disk 8139too generic 8139cp mii uhci_hcd usbcore piix ide_core processor
dbnnsh:/usr/src/linux/scripts#
//edit
używaj tagów code
mlyczek
: 16 września 2007, 15:45
autor: sirgomo
ver_linux pokazuje ci jakie masz biblioteki, porownaj je z tym co masz w dokumentacji jadra w pliku changes, tam rowniez masz podane dokladne komendy jak sprawdzic recznie jaka masz wersje danej biblioteki...
zdravim
: 16 września 2007, 20:24
autor: Kaka'
Problem z Kernelem
Los, proszę popraw tytuł tematu na mówiący konkretnie o problemie. W przypadku zignorowania prośby, temat poleci do kosza.